The Galaxy A42 is much better than the Motorola DROID Turbo 2, getting an 87 score against 75.4. Galaxy A42's body is much newer and just a little thinner than Motorola DROID Turbo 2's, but it is heavier. The Motorola DROID Turbo 2 features an incredibly better screen than Samsung Galaxy A42, because although it has a quite smaller display, it also counts with a lot better 1440 x 2560 resolution and a much better number of pixels per inch of display.
The Samsung Galaxy A42 counts with just a bit bigger storage capacity for games and applications than Motorola DROID Turbo 2, because although it has a slot for an external memory card that allows up to 1000 GB against 1,95 TB, it also counts with 128 GB internal storage capacity. The Galaxy A42 counts with a little bit better processing power than Motorola DROID Turbo 2, and although they both have a Octa-Core CPU, the Galaxy A42 also has a larger amount of RAM.
The Galaxy A42 shoots much better photos and videos than Motorola DROID Turbo 2, and although they both have the same video frame rates and the same (4K) video resolution, the Galaxy A42 also has a way more mega-pixels back facing camera and a bigger aperture to capture better photos and videos in low light situations.
Samsung Galaxy A42 counts with improved battery duration than Motorola DROID Turbo 2, because it has 5000mAh of battery capacity against 3760mAh.
